Princess 68 takes to the water for sea trial

Motorboat & Yachting: The new flybridge from Princess has undergone its first sea trial, hitting a top speed in excess of 30 knots.

 

Following a highly impressive debut at the 2014 PSP Southampton Boat Show, the Princess 68 has taken to the water for its first sea trial.

The latest flybridge to come out of Princess’s Plymouth facility fits in between the 64 and the 72 Motor Yacht, and comes fitted with twin 1,150hp engines from Caterpillar.

On trial these propelled it up to a maximum speed in excess of 30 knots, with a comfortable cruising speed of 20 knots. Princess claims that the 68 is capable of 34 knots flat out and will deliver “greater fuel efficiency”, two claims we hope to put to the test in the near future.

The Plymouth-based manufacturer adds that the 69ft hull’s variable underwater geometry makes for a smoother ride, while the resin-infused composite built method helps to keep the weight down.
